Beauty salon dream comes true in Twickenham for mum-of-one
7:00am Thursday 11th October 2012 in News By Rachel Bishop
A mother-of-one has become the proud owner of a new beauty salon after years of hard work juggling training with motherhood from the age of 17.
Gemma Paine, now in her 30s, is the owner of Totally U Beauty in east Twickenham, having started working toward her goal at a young age.
Ms Paine said: “At the age of the age of 17, I was living in a council flat, a bored mum of one. I wanted to start a career in something I loved.”
She completed several part-time courses, fitting them around caring for her son, and started working in a members-only spa when her son was a little older.
She then felt confident enough to venture out on her own and start up her own business.
She added: “My business is my whole life as are my family and things are going from strength to strength.”
